Political office is service to the people, not oppression, Gov. Buni tasks politicians

From our correspondent, in Damaturu

 

The Yobe state Governor, Hon. Mai Mala Buni, has urged politicians across the state to see politics as service to society and an opportunity to impact on human communities.

Governor Buni made the called during the swearing-in ceremony of the newly appointed Commissioners, Head of Service, Permanent Secretaries and Special Advisers in Damaturu.

The Governor said that when politics was not seen as a form of service, it could become a means of oppression, marginalisation and even destruction.

He advised politicians to take politics seriously with a view to affirm the duty of each individual to acknowledge the reality and value of the freedom offered to serve.

Governor Buni also called on politicians to desist from jealousy and envy. “I want to caution that people should desist from jealousy and envy. For everyone of us, Almighty Allah has apportioned a provision and no one will take that away.

“Ours is a government of one family, we will continue to support and create job opportunities for our people to enable them recover fully from the destruction of the Boko Haram insurgency, and make life more meaningful to our people”.

Commenting on the importance of peace in the state, he called on people to continue to pray for peace and bumper harvest in this year’s cropping season.

He urged civil servants and politicians in the state to go back to farm. “Every resident should fully get involved by planting crops or engaging in animal husbandry for food security in the state and the country”.

“We are investing massively on agriculture this year, even as we are going to provide farming inputs to at least 20 youths from each political wards in the state, to empower the people especially youths”, he said.
